      <description>&lt;P&gt;I installed SAS 9.4 (9.4, EG and EM)&amp;nbsp;on my new laptop (windows 10). However, neither EM nor EG were installed (just SAS 9.4). Now, I have been trying to uninstall SAS, but it is not possible because of "unwritable files" during the "preparing to uninstall sas system products" process. There are 27 unwritable files. All of them are in SASHome\SASWebApplicationServer\9.4\tomcat-7.0.55.A.RELEASE\lib&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I will really appreciate any help.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thank you&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>Hi &lt;a href="https://communities.sas.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/143803"&gt;@cristiancon&lt;/a&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Kindly check this note and see if this helps.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Note: Starting with a freshly rebooted system helps prevent files from being locked in memory. When files are locked in memory during the installation process, you will receive messages about unwritable files in the Checking System window. See SAS Note 55022 for more information.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;A href="http://support.sas.com/kb/55/022.html" target="_blank"&gt;http://support.sas.com/kb/55/022.html&lt;/A&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Thanks,&lt;BR /&gt;Anand!</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;a href="https://communities.sas.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/13976"&gt;@SASKiwi&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;- Most likely &lt;a href="https://communities.sas.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/143803"&gt;@cristiancon&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;installed SAS Studio along with 9.4, EG, and EM, which is why SAS Web Server was installed and running. Opening up the Windows Services Snap-In (Start -&amp;gt; Run -&amp;gt; services.msc) and stopping SASStudioSpawner and SASStudioWebAppServer would have made uninstallation possible.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
